Output e91cd4a41544cce2992b30ca27f72d8f4d96b1d716b5e9641d0a6ae3e26cc676:3

value
17563
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 0bb9ad39b79fafaec055f67d53d43b6a8141205ab720479cb5c94a5ddb8a66b5
address
ltc1ppwu66wdhn7h6asz47e7484pmd2q5zgz6kusy0894e999mku2v66su5cnq0
transaction
e91cd4a41544cce2992b30ca27f72d8f4d96b1d716b5e9641d0a6ae3e26cc676
spent
true